Pine Tree Clearing in Houston, TX
Pine tree clearing services involve the removal of pine trees and their associated debris to improve the safety, appearance, and functionality of residential properties. This service is commonly requested for projects such as clearing overgrown areas, preparing land for new construction or landscaping, removing hazardous or dying trees, and managing dense wooded sections to prevent damage from fallen branches or trees. Property owners should consider factors like the size and number of trees, proximity to structures or utility lines, and the overall condition of the trees when requesting pine tree clearing. Understanding these details helps ensure the project is completed efficiently and safely.
Before requesting pine tree clearing, homeowners often want to know about the scope of the work, including whether the service includes stump removal, debris cleanup, and disposal. It’s also helpful to clarify if any permits are needed for tree removal in the area and to discuss access to the property. Knowing the extent of the work and the specific goals for the property can assist in planning the project and ensuring it meets the desired outcomes.

Pine Tree Clearing Questions
What is pine tree clearing? Pine tree clearing involves removing or trimming pine trees to improve safety, aesthetics, or property use.
When is the best time for pine tree removal? The ideal time for clearing is typically during dormancy periods, but it can vary based on the project needs.
Are there different methods of pine tree clearing? Yes, methods include selective trimming, stump grinding, and complete removal, depending on the project requirements.
What should property owners consider before pine tree clearing? Consider the size, location, and health of the trees, as well as any potential impact on surrounding landscape.
